Transaction 7954ccf2824e09900791398761353235f95519717fcb512975a4842ba0e1b65b
1 Input
1 Output
-
7954ccf2824e09900791398761353235f95519717fcb512975a4842ba0e1b65b:0
- value
- 376761
- script pubkey
- OP_0 OP_PUSHBYTES_32 b2c872b7827678ebfaffd0d8dd77b08d4af2a8ddcf32d26005f12b79eb9501aa
- address
- bc1qkty89duzweuwh7hl6rvd6aas349092xaeuedycq97y4hn6u4qx4qwar95g